For every $1 invested in early childcare, the US economy gains $7 in terms of reduced teen pregnancy, improved graduation rates, improved performance in school, and reduced incarceration rates. In fact, in 34 US states the cost to send an infant or toddler to a childcare center is higher than tuition at an in-state public university.
